Abstract

1518500 Bicomponent fibres; polyamides and polyurethanes COURTAULDS Ltd 24 Oct 1975 [26 Nov 1974] 51114/74 Heading B5B [Also in Division C3] A bicomponent fibre comprises a polyamide and an elastic polyurethane formed by the reaction of a diisocyanate with a hydroxy terminated polyester or polyether, a non- polymeric diol and a triol (up to 3 molar per cent based on the non polymeric diol), the elastomer having a melting point of 200-235‹ C. The bicomponent is melt spun in the conventional manner, stretched to a draw ratio of greater than 3 : 1 and released to form a crimped fibre.
